Trailer Floor.....Mill Finish Aluminum Cleaning
 
Anyone got the "trick lick" on cleaning trailer floors---Mill Finish Aluminum Treadplate or Extruded----Black marks accumulate on that too but it seems to be very tricky to spot clean without leaving a noticable black "smudge"...any suggestions ????

I just did mine. Get yourself an orbital floor polisher and put the most abrasive pad they have on it. (looks like black Scotch Bright). I used 409 cleaner but Iam sure Simple Green or some other cleaner/de-greaser will work. Run that bad boy on the whole trailer floor, and it looks like new.

I'd go light on the abrasive disc using one of the milder ones. Simple green and wet floor work great. You get a rythm and you can make a nice pattern without gouging the aluminum. THEN when you rinse it out and it is dry and you are satisfied .... Take some Liquid floor wax ( MOP and GLOW)
and spread it on with a rag by hand all over this helps slow the oxidation and marks.
Good luck it takes time and energy but it DOES look like new...

Be caraeful with the use of abrasives on aluminum unless your plan to apply a primer or epoxy paint. The abrasive will remove the annealing and then you will have a corrosion issue with the aluminum. Use the RV-455 and you will be safer.
